Can someone help me real quick with an intake prob???

I'm trying to put this K&N filter on but I don't have the mid-pipe. When i took the stock airbox off I saw this wire connected to this lil' sensor inside. How would I attach this to the K&N?? Or what do I do?? Thanks if sombody could help.

Cyrus,

I think you simply have them switched. The tiny piece in the tube is the Air Mass Sensor, a.k.a MAF, more technically, the MAS (Mass Airflow Sensor).

The one that attaches to the stock airbox is the ambient air temperature sensor. This piece costs around $51 retail from Nissan, while the MAF is $370. Be careful with this tube!
